3D machine vision is the application of 3D imaging techniques in industrial processes, focusing on tasks like inspection, measurement, and automation. It combines cameras, sensors, and software to analyze objects in three dimensions for improved precision and efficiency. In manufacturing, 3D machine vision is used for quality control. Systems can detect defects, measure dimensions, and ensure products meet specifications. For example, automotive industries rely on it to verify weld integrity and align components during assembly. Another application is robotic guidance. 3D vision helps robots accurately pick and place items, even in unstructured environments. This is essential in warehouses and logistics, where objects may vary in size and orientation. Additionally, it supports processes like bin picking and palletizing in factories.
